M-22: A Lake Michigan Lover's Dream


If there's one drive that captures the essence of Michigan's appeal, it's M-22. This route winds along the Lake Michigan shoreline and through the Sleeping Bear Dunes National Lakeshore. The views are motion picture-- looming dunes, stretching wineries, quaint harbor communities, and glittering blue water that seems to take place for life.


You may find yourself pulling over often, not due to a tire repair service emergency situation, yet because you simply can not resist breaking a picture or getting a cherry pie from a roadside stand. From Manistee to Traverse City, every stop is a treasure, and every mile seems like a postcard.


The Tunnel of Trees: A Canopy of Natural Wonder


The Tunnel of Trees, formally known as M-119, is greater than just a drive-- it's an experience. Leaving Lake Michigan's northeastern edge from Harbor Springs to Cross Village, this slim roadway is enveloped in a thick canopy of wood trees that rupture right into flaming reds, oranges, and yellows each autumn.

US-2 Across the Upper Peninsula: Untamed and Unforgettable


Cross the famous Mackinac Bridge and you'll find yourself in Michigan's wilder side-- the Upper Peninsula. US-2 takes you western along the Lake Michigan shoreline, where the views really feel unblemished and raw. Pine woodlands stretch for miles, freshwater beaches glimmer in the sunlight, and roadside pull-offs disclose private treasures.

The Copper Country Trail: History Meets Rugged Beauty


For something genuinely off the beaten track, the Copper Country Trail in the Keweenaw Peninsula supplies a mix of all-natural elegance and abundant heritage. This stretch winds through old mining communities, dense forests, and cliffside hunts that provide sweeping sights of Lake Superior.

Bluewater Highway: The Coastal Route Through Eastern Michigan


On the east side of the state, the Bluewater Highway (M-25) traces the curve of Lake Huron. Beginning near Port Huron and traveling north to Bay City, this drive showcases lighthouses, coastal towns, and countless views of freshwater waves.
